Maximizing Visual Hierarchy and Readability
While Blue Unicorn is undeniably charming, successful graphic design relies on balance. Using a display font effectively means understanding when to let it shine and when to step back. Overusing any single typeface can lead to visual clutter, so it is crucial to pair it with complementary fonts.
For body text, choose a clean, neutral sans-serif or serif that provides high readability. This contrast creates a clear visual hierarchy, guiding the viewer's eye from the impactful headline down to the essential information. The thick letters of Blue Unicorn act as anchors, drawing attention to key messages without overwhelming the content. When designing for UX (User Experience), ensure that the color palette chosen supports the font. High-contrast combinations, such as white text on a deep blue background, enhance legibility while maintaining the font's vibrant spirit.
Integration into Professional Workflows
Integrating unique typography into a professional setting requires strategic planning. Before downloading or purchasing a font family, evaluate how it fits within your existing design system. Consider the following factors:
- Scalability: Does the font remain crisp and recognizable when resized for mobile screens or large-format billboards?
- Audience Expectations: Will the playful tone resonate with your target demographic, or does it clash with industry norms?
- Licensing and Usage: Ensure the license covers all intended uses, from web embedding to commercial print runs.
- Compatibility: Test the font against your current color palette and imagery to ensure a harmonious composition.
